First, in terms of material, I decided to try clear TPU for its flexibility (and since that seemed to be the material most of the earlier posts mentioned). However, Brandon mentioned to me a couple other alternatives - PETG or nGen. They are more rigid, but can still have a little bit of flex. I didn't look into these other materials so I can't compare.

Also, when I asked for "clear" TPU, I was told that it is never really clear. The clarity depends on how many "layers" you print. The more layers (more opaque), the greater the ability to "diffuse" light and refract it since it has to pass through more layers. The less layers (more clear), the better for light to pass directly through it, but you won't see it as much from the side.

Number of layers is related to the layer "height." The taller the height, the less layers you can fit into your print. I originally selected 500 microns, but was told that was an overly thick layer and the printer would not be able to print the thin "fins" at the top with that setting. So, I lowered it to 300 microns. Not sure it that will achieve the desired effect, but I'll have to wait and see when it arrives.

My guess is with the varying combinations of layer height / # of layers / clarity, one can foreseeably play around with some settings and get an ideal amount of light passing through vs. diffused light.
